CMA Calendar Change Survey Decision

CMA Calendar Change Survey Decision

Thanks to all CMA families for your participation in the calendar change survey following our parent interest meeting January 11, 2010and faculty discussion over the past few weeks. The Site Based Decision Making Team met today, 1/26 to discuss the calendar change and the survey results.

The majority of parents and the vast majority of faculty support a calendar change to align with Durham Technical Community College calendar. In light of the parental and faculty feedback, CMA will apply for a state waiver regarding a calendar change to start August 2011. This time line gives all parents, students and faculty ample time and opportunity to make informed decisions about school choice.

Thank you all again for participating in this decision making process.
